The Dwarf pine grows in the Dolomites on an altitude of 1200 - 2700 m and is well known and appreciated because of its soothing and digestive characteristics. The fresh pine cones are collected between May and June and afterwards put into cold, fresh grappa for about 45 days. Our Dwarf pine grappa is further characterised by its intense flavour and - thanks to the pine cones - also by the traditional woody fragrance.

Alcoholic strength: 
40% vol.

Woodruff is a plant growing in the underwood, on an altitude of 600-700 m and is partularly appreciated for its digestive properties. The plant is generally harvested in May and afterwards left to infusion with fresh grappa and bottled with a branch of fresh woodruff. This grappa is further characterised by a fine and fresh herbal taste.

Alcoholic strength: 40% vol.

The stone pine is a tree that usually grows on an altitude of 1800 m and is appreciated for its digestive and soothing properties. The cones are left to infuse cold in fresh grappa with stone pine cones that will confer the traditional red colour. Spicy and unique flavour. 

Alcoholic strength: 40% vol.

In South Tyrol caraway (carum carvi) is largely used to spice bread, pies, cheese and cabbage and is very appreciated due to its aromatic and digestive properties. This grappa is obtained from the infusion of caraway seeds in fresh grappa for about 30 days. Strong and spicy flavour. 

Alcoholic strength: 40% vol.

This grappa is with all the different herbs (juniper berries, mountain pine cones, woodruff, gentian and liquorice roots as well as pine cones) for about 45 days. Excellent ingredients that are known for their digestive properties. This herb grappa is characterised by a very strong, persistent and light bitter taste. 

Alcoholic strength: 40% vol.

Gentian roots are known for their digestive and invigorating properties. The roots were dried for about 30 days and afterwards left in fresh grappa. Our gentian grappa is characterised by a lighlty bitter taste and can calso be served cool. 

Alcoholic strength: 40% vol.

Juniper usually grows on an altitude of 1000m. It's berries are appreciated for their diuretic, digestive and soothing properties. The fresh and ripe juniper berries are lightly crushed before left in fresh grappa for about 45 days. Afterwards the grappa is bottled with a juniper branch. Our juniper grappa is characterised by a very strong and persistent taste. 

Alcoholic strength: 40% vol.

Liquorice is known for its excellent digestive characteristics. The dried and smashed liquorice roots were left in fresh grappa for about 45 days. The flavour is delicated and perfect to be served cool. 

Alcoholic strength: 40% vol.

Honey is known and appreciated for its invigorating and reinforcing characteristics. The honey is left in fresh grappa for about 30 days. This process gives the grappa its excellent, organoleptic features. Due to the honey, this grappa is characterised by a slightly sweet taste. 

Alcoholic strength: 40% vol.

Nettles usually grow right next to rivers or on the edge of forests and is well known for its digestive characteristics. Nettles are harvested in spring and left to infuse cold in fresh grappa for about 45 days. Afterwards the liqueur is bottled with a fresh branch. This liqueur featured a herbaceous, slightly pungent taste. 

Alcoholic strength: 40% vol.

Rue is a plant that grows on poor soil or in wine regions. It is well known for its digestive and diuretic characteristics and is usually harvested before its flowering time. It is then left for about 30 days in fresh grappa and finally bottled with a fresh rue branch. Our rue grappa is characterised by a smooth, soft and slightly herbaceous taste.

Alcoholic strength: 40% vol.

For the production of this liqueur, we select various herbs deriving from our wildflower meadows, which are sited at the altitudes of 1000 to 1300 meters. The herbs are left to infuse for approximately 45 days: the active ingredients and properties of the raw materials could be preserved. The scent of this infusion is reminiscent of that one of the freshly harvested hay, and the taste is intense, herbaceous and persistent.

Alcoholic strength: 30% vol.

Ginger is a well-known medicinal plant. Its root has anti-inflammatory, invigorating and digestive properties. The roots of fresh ginger are peeled and then steeped in new grappa for around 20 days. The resulting infusion is then mixed with orange peel and alcohol. It has a spicy and refreshing flavour with a delicious finish. We recommend serving our ginger liqueur cold.

Alcoholic strength: 30% vol.

Elderflowers have digestive and anti-inflammatory properties. We pick the blossoms in mid-May in valley locations and from the beginning of June in the mountains, just above 800 metres, so that we can bring the best product to the bottle for you. We use freshly harvested elderflowers to make our liqueur. They are cold-infused in high quality grappa for approximately 20 days. The resulting product is mixed with alcohol and lemon. It has a refreshing, fruity and long-lasting flavour.

Alcoholic strength: 30% vol.

Camomile flowers have relaxing and digestive properties. Our liqueur is extracted from camomile flowers from the highest mountains. As soon as the flowers have dried, they are placed in the new grappa and cold-infused for around 20 days. We recommend serving our camomile liqueur cold. The camomile liqueur has a floral fragrance and a light, mellow flavour.

Alcoholic strength: 24% vol.
